- Module ai-tools-view: types, constants (AI_TOOLS), useAIToolsView, ToolGrid, Workspace, Skeleton, orchestrator AIToolsView - Re-export from AIToolsView.tsx - Stories: Default, Loading (Skeleton); decorator min-h-layout-page, no local ToastProvider (use StorybookDecorator) - Fix: text-[10px] -> text-xs, min-h-[400px] -> min-h-layout-page-sm Co-authored-by: Cursor <cursoragent@cursor.com>
24 lines
588 B
TypeScript
24 lines
588 B
TypeScript
import type { Meta, StoryObj } from '@storybook/react';
|
|
import { AIToolsView, AIToolsViewSkeleton } from './ai-tools-view';
|
|
|
|
const meta = {
|
|
title: 'Components/Features/Studio/AIToolsView',
|
|
component: AIToolsView,
|
|
tags: ['autodocs'],
|
|
decorators: [
|
|
(Story) => (
|
|
<div className="bg-kodo-background min-h-layout-page p-4">
|
|
<Story />
|
|
</div>
|
|
),
|
|
],
|
|
} satisfies Meta<typeof AIToolsView>;
|
|
|
|
export default meta;
|
|
type Story = StoryObj<typeof meta>;
|
|
|
|
export const Default: Story = {};
|
|
|
|
export const Loading: Story = {
|
|
render: () => <AIToolsViewSkeleton />,
|
|
};
|